## Fan-out Backpressure

Pushfield fans notifications out to device channels via Quillfeather workers. When downstream queues exceed the high-water mark, producers throttle automatically; do not disable this manually. Symptoms of saturation: rising publish latency, shed low-priority batches. First response: check worker pool health, then queue depth. Full backpressure tuning guidance is on the internal engineering page.

wiki page, hahog-yahog: https://jira.plorvaworks.corp/display/dash/pages/pages/repo/display/spaces/7b9c5df2c5490ad9694860b5

**ALERT: lockerflow-access-failures-high**

The Tumblewash laundry-locker access flow is failing above threshold: residents scan their fob, the Hatchkey service times out, and lockers stay sealed. Usually caused by the badge-validation cache going stale after a Hatchkey deploy. Check recent deploys first; if one landed in the last hour, flush the cache and confirm unlock success rate recovers within five minutes. Escalate to the access-platform team if not. Cache flush steps are on the internal page below.

operations page: https://confluence.norvacorp.corp/spaces/dash/dash/a5a4e1c207d6

## Service Accounts — StormFan Alert Fan-Out

The fan-out worker authenticates to the internal dispatch tier using the svc-stormfan account. Rotate quarterly; scopes are limited to publish-only on alert topics. If deliveries stall during your shift, verify the worker is using the current credential, reproduced below for reference.

API key for kaweg-hahif: kto4_rAjZ

## Runbook: Config Hot-Reload — Driftlane Service

Quick note for review: hot-reload now watches the overlay directory instead of polling, so config changes land in under two seconds without a restart. If a reload fails validation, the service keeps the last good snapshot — no flapping. One gotcha: reloaded bundles still go through signature verification, same as cold starts, so don't skip signing even for tiny tweaks. Push your reviewed config bundle signed with the key below.

deploy key for hawef-bafog: bky13_1N9K4SjjejvXh